//给你一个 只包含正整数 的 非空 数组 nums 。请你判断是否可以将这个数组分割成两个子集,使得两个子集的元素和相等。
//
//
//
// 示例 1
//
//
//输入nums = [1,5,11,5]
//输出true
//解释:数组可以分割成 [1, 5, 5] 和 [11] 。
//
// 示例 2
//
//
//输入nums = [1,2,3,5]
//输出false
//解释:数组不能分割成两个元素和相等的子集。
//
//
//
//
// 提示:
//
//
// 1 <= nums.length <= 200
// 1 <= nums[i] <= 100

package leetcode.editor.cn;
//416:分割等和子集
class PartitionEqualSubsetSum {
public static void main(String[] args) {
//测试代码
Solution solution = new PartitionEqualSubsetSum().new Solution();
}
//力扣代码
//leetcode submit region begin(Prohibit modification and deletion)
class Solution {
public boolean canPartition(int[] nums) {
int sum = 0;
for (int num : nums) {
sum += num;
}
int length = nums.length;
if (sum % 2 == 1)
return false;
boolean[][] dp = new boolean[length + 1][sum / 2 + 1];
dp[0][0] = true;
for (int i = 1; i <= length; i++) {
for (int j = 0; j <= sum / 2; j++) {
if (j >= nums[i - 1]) {
dp[i][j] |= dp[i - 1][j - nums[i - 1]];
}
dp[i][j] |= dp[i - 1][j];
}
}
return dp[length][sum / 2];
}
}
//leetcode submit region end(Prohibit modification and deletion)
}
